North Las Vegas Police Department officers arrested two suspects during a proactive investigation, seizing an illegal firearm and oxycodone pills. Authorities said the individuals are suspected of involvement in narcotics sales.
A NLVPD spokesperson praised the officers’ overnight work, saying, “This is the kind of work happening around the clock when most of our community is sleeping, our officers are out there preventing crime, interrupting illegal drug activity, and protecting our neighborhoods.” The arrests also removed contraband items from the streets, enhancing public safety.
According to the NLVPD, the suspects were booked on gun and narcotics charges. Police said the arrests reflect ongoing efforts to combat illegal activity and protect the community…
